Coachman With Horse And Dog

1859
oil on canvas
no dimensions avaliable

Louisiana State Museum

New Orleans, LA

notes
This painting was among the earliest collected by the Louisiana State Museum, but unfortunately there is little documentation about the lame horse or the black coachman who leads him. The coachman, whether a slave or a free person of color, reflects the southern character of the painting.
